Here is a bit of history on the origin of the cajon:
The cajon is a classic folk & pure "jug" instrument. (Jug instruments are instruments made from common, household, or work, supplies.)
The first cajons were the simplest box drums. In Peru and box drums were used as early as the 16th century. Some of, if not, the first box drums were made from fish crates by African slaves. These served as replacement percussion for their native drums.
Also, in Cuba, people have been transforming small dresser drawers into box drums for centuries.
In time these jug instruments were refined and became an important part of Peruvian and Cuban music.
Pine and other white wood with three quarter inch thickness was used on the five, solid sides of the box. The sixth, & final side was made up of a thin sheet of plywood. This thin sheet was equivalent to the drum head, and hence, the most common playing surface.
The top edges could be slapped against the box because they were often loose. A hole was cut in the side opposite the head, which allowed more sound to escape. To play the box, a player simply sat on it so that the striking surface was between his legs.
The cajon is most popular in Andean, Cuban, and Flamenco music, but it's down to earth, percussive qualities have become popular in various acoustic music settings.

PB, from what I understand some of the snare cajons allow you to turn the snares off vs the string or wire cajons. As far as a sound difference I'm just not sure Lol, never got the chance to play them side by side.
But I would think that the sound difference would really depend on the type of wood used as well as the type of wood used on the face plate. You can also loosen the front plate or tighten it until you've reached the desired sound. Probably also depends on where the port is located and the size of the port.
